How to Pick the Right Car Seat Back Protector
Coverage and fit: Look for a protector that matches the height and width of your seat back, especially if you drive an SUV, minivan, or have deeply contoured seats. A good fit should shield the upholstery from shoe scuffs, dirt, and spills without bunching up or sliding down.
Attachment system: Secure straps and adjustable buckles matter more than they seem. The protector should stay snug behind the seat even when kids kick it or passengers adjust the seat position. If the straps are too loose, the cover can sag and leave the lower seat exposed.
Material and cleanability: Choose a wipeable, water-resistant surface that can handle muddy shoes, crumbs, and drink spills. Quilted or padded designs can add extra protection, but make sure the material is still easy to clean and won’t trap debris in seams.
Non-obvious detail: seat compatibility: Check whether the protector works with built-in seat airbags, seat controls, and rear-seat pockets. Some bulky models can interfere with power seat movement or block access to storage pockets, which becomes frustrating fast.

Common Questions About Car Seat Back Protector
Q: Is Car Seat Back Protector worth the investment?
Yes, especially if you have kids, ride-share passengers, pets, or frequently travel with dirty shoes and gear. It can help prevent permanent scuffs, stains, and wear on seatbacks, which may save money on interior repairs later.
Q: What’s a good alternative to Car Seat Back Protector?
A seat-back organizer can offer some protection while adding storage, but it usually does not cover as much surface area. A full-seat cover provides broader protection, though it may be less convenient if you only want to shield the back of the seat.
Q: How do I maintain/care for Car Seat Back Protector?
Wipe it down regularly with a damp cloth and mild soap if needed, and follow the manufacturer’s cleaning instructions for the material. Check straps and attachment points occasionally so the protector stays tight and continues to cover the seat properly.
